Output 8528e44c881432aefb80fa2ba9203c9c1417208bc7e58c2c5bb3cab1ad612397:1

value
64895651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 768ddd3c5887491d35e5844e2ca3128ffc0ebcd4 OP_EQUAL
address
3CVsc5SJoYLkd2efwGR8BxavmE3yTNfY5g
transaction
8528e44c881432aefb80fa2ba9203c9c1417208bc7e58c2c5bb3cab1ad612397
spent
true